Dallas Wings star Paige Bueckers surprised young fans in the Twin Cities by unveiling a newly refurbished basketball court at Blackstone Park. The community event took place following the Wings’ matchup against the Minnesota Lynx, highlighting Bueckers’ ongoing commitment to grassroots basketball development and community engagement in the region.

Community Impact and Twin Cities Roots
For basketball fans in the Minneapolis-Saint Paul area, seeing Bueckers back on local blacktops carries a distinct resonance. Blackstone Park served as the latest canvas for investment in urban athletic infrastructure, providing local youth with a modernized, safe environment to hone their skills. The timing of the unveiling—scheduled immediately after a grueling WNBA regular-season fixture against the Minnesota Lynx—underscores a demanding schedule successfully balanced with civic responsibility.
Modern basketball infrastructure initiatives rely heavily on player-led advocacy and corporate backing to bridge funding gaps in municipal parks departments. Upgrades at neighborhood sites like Blackstone Park typically feature resilient all-weather acrylic surfacing, regulation-grade hoop systems, and optimized drainage—elements critical for withstanding upper-midwestern seasonal shifts. By stepping directly from the professional hardwood into neighborhood community spaces, elite athletes help maintain grassroots engagement in regions with rich basketball traditions.
